Legal issues and structures:
Accountability can be defined as the obligation of the nurses to perform duties, tasks as
well as roles with the proper use of the judgment. The nurse should be answerable for the
decisions made in doing this. Accountability can be defined as the duty by which nurses should
be able to provide an account of their judgments, actions as well as their omissions.
Accountability can be defined as maintaining competency and thereby includes safeguarding
quality patient care outcomes as well as maintaining the standards of professional at the same
time of being answerable to those who are affected by one’s nursing and midwifery practice
(Kangasniemi, Pakkanen & Korhonen, 2015). Therefore, breaches in both the attributes may
result in legal obligation harming the health of the patient due to negligence of care affecting
human rights. Breaching the acts of beneficence, equality of care to all irrespective of class and
creed and many others may lead to obligations when professionals are not responsible and
accountable.
Professional boundaries to be maintained:
One of the most important aspects that should be maintained by the healthcare
professionals while providing care is confidentiality and privacy. Overriding the professional
boundary may result in not only harmful impact on the patient but also results in cancellation of
license and getting involved in legal obligation. Breaching the aspects may affect the personal
life as well as professional lives of the patients that may expose them to violence, harassment,
abuse, humiliation or attacks and many others (Parandeh et al., 2015). Often many of the nurses
are seen to override their professional boundaries by enclosing information of patients over
social media that leads to many legal obligations of professionals and breach in human rights of

Professional values and morals:
Professional values mainly help in guiding the different practices of the nurses ensuring
that the patients are not only satisfied with their care but that all the care services are following
ethical and legal frameworks. Respecting human dignity, social justice as well as altruism is
some of the values that ensure self less devotion to the patients. Autonomy in decision making as
well as precision and accuracy in caring ensure that patients not only get high quality care but
also can develop a trust on the professionals that have positive impacts on their emotional and
mental health. Responsibility and inculcating effective traits to maintain human relationships are
the ways by which nurses can develop therapeutic relationship with the patients (McCarthy &
Gastmans, 2015). Mutual respect, trust and reliance along with caring for patients with love and
kindness are some of the foundations of nursing profession. Sympathy, empathy, compassion,
integrity and competency ensure professionals to develop bonding with patients that ensure
compliance of the patients with the treatments and hence result in better quality care.
Challenges:
Healthcare professionals often face many incidences where they go through ethical
dilemmas. These ethical dilemmas mainly rise from the conflict of the bio-ethical principles that
include beneficence and autonomy. Autonomy instructs professionals to perform care services
after consents from the patient and conducting the interventions according to the preferences and
consents of the patients (Alkaya, Yaman & Simones, 2018). On the other hand, beneficence
ensured professionals to provide care that are safest and have best health outcomes. Often there
